What companies run services between Heathrow Terminal 4, England and Brixton Market,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Heathrow Terminal 4 station to Green Park station every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£3–6 and the journey takes 52 min.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Heathrow Terminal 4 to Brixton Market via Heathrow Central Bus Station, London Victoria, Victoria Station, and Brixton Station in around 1h 56m.
